Benefits of PBR

• Improved safety performance and clearly identified safety outcomes• Resources (industry & regulatory) can be targeted strategically to the

areas with the greatest potential to deliver safety improvements• CAA Board can make more strategic decisions based on real safety

data using the Regulatory SMS understanding systemic risk• CAA is a credible partner to industry rather than a pure compliance

checking mechanism• Improved information flow to really understand risk and encourage

evidence based decisions• Comparability of existing data helps industry to feedback evidence

more easily and identify trends• Safety is at the forefront of PBR, but the other areas are seeing the

benefits of the integrated approach
